Puerto Iguazú

A natural paradise in the province of Misiones, Argentina. It is only 14 km from the Iguazu Falls, one of the seven natural wonders of the world. Known for its impressive waterfalls, this region is a must-see tourist destination.

About Iguazu Falls

The main place to visit is the impressive Iguazu Falls, declared a UNESCO World Heritage Site and considered one of the seven wonders of the world. Here, you can walk along the trails and see the waterfalls from different angles, including the imposing Garganta del Diablo (Devil’s Throat). Also, don’t miss the boat ride on the Iguazú River, where you can get even closer to the waterfalls and enjoy incredible views.

More info from Iguazú Falls

In terms of activities and excursions, you can do everything from bike rides in the Iguazu National Park to guided tours in the subtropical rainforest. Also, you can experience an exciting adventure in the upper and lower circuit of the waterfalls, experience a great adventure or an ecological walk in the water park “Iguazú Jungle”.
Also, if you want to do adventure tourism activities in Puerto Iguazú, they offer canopy or rappel in the jungle. And if you are a nature lover, you cannot miss a visit to the Bird Park with more than 800 species of tropical birds.
For history and culture lovers, we recommend a visit to the Museo Imágenes de la Selva.

Regarding gastronomy, you can try the famous “asado de tira”, a grilled meat delicacy. Also, the “empanadas de mandioca” and the “chipá”, a bread made with manioc and cheese.
To sleep, we recommend staying in one of the hotels overlooking the waterfalls, such as the Hotel Loi Suites Iguazú, the Hotel Panoramic or the Hotel Meliá Iguazú. Another option is to stay in cabins or camping sites in the Iguazú National Park.
